Understanding the Mechanics of a Tire Bead

Before diving into the process, you must understand what creates the seal. Modern tubeless tires rely on a mechanical fit between the tire bead and the rim flange.

The bead is a bundle of high-strength steel wires encased in rubber. When you inflate the tire, internal pressure forces this bead against the inner lip of the rim.

If there is any debris, corrosion, or damage in this contact area, air will escape. This is why a clean surface is the most important factor in a successful seal.

The Role of the Rim Flange

The rim flange is the outermost edge of the wheel that holds the tire in place. Over time, moisture can get trapped here, leading to oxidation or rust.

On aluminum wheels, this often looks like white, crusty powder. On steel wheels, it appears as flaky orange rust that creates an uneven surface.

The Bead Seat Area

The bead seat is the flat horizontal surface just inside the flange. This is where the tire bead rests once it is fully seated and pressurized.

Any deep gouges in this area from previous tire changes can cause a persistent leak. Inspecting this area is the first step in troubleshooting a leaky wheel.

Essential Tools and Materials for a Perfect Seal

To do the job right, you need more than just an air compressor. Professional results require specific chemicals and tools designed for rubber-to-metal contact.

First, you will need a high-quality bead sealer. This is a thick, black liquid rubber compound that fills in minor imperfections on the rim.

You will also need a valve core removal tool. Removing the core allows a massive volume of air to enter the tire quickly, which is necessary to “pop” the bead into place.

  • Wire Brush or Sandpaper: For removing corrosion from the rim.
  • Tire Lubricant: Specialized “tire soap” or a mild dish soap and water mixture.
  • Air Compressor: A tank-style compressor is preferred over small portable inflators for seating beads.
  • Brake Cleaner: To degrease the rim surface before applying sealer.
  • Pressure Gauge: To ensure you do not exceed the tire’s maximum seating pressure.

How to Seal a Tire to the Rim: The Step-by-Step Process

Once you have your tools ready, it is time to begin the actual work. Following this sequence ensures that you don’t have to do the job twice because of a missed step.

Start by completely deflating the tire and breaking the bead away from the rim. You can use a dedicated bead breaker or a large C-clamp if you are working in a home garage.

Push the tire bead down toward the center “drop center” of the rim. This gives you enough space to inspect the flange and the bead itself for any hidden damage.

Step 1: Clean the Contact Surfaces

Take your wire brush or a piece of 80-grit sandpaper and scrub the inner flange of the rim. You want to remove all traces of old rubber, rust, and corrosion.

Wipe the area down with a clean rag soaked in brake cleaner. The surface must be dry and free of oils for the bead sealer to bond effectively.

Step 2: Inspect the Tire Bead

Check the rubber bead of the tire for “chunks” or tears. If the internal steel wires are showing, the tire is likely unsafe and should be replaced.

If the bead is just dirty, wipe it down with soapy water. Small bits of sand or gravel are common culprits for slow leaks in off-road vehicles.

Step 3: Apply the Bead Sealer

Using the brush attached to the sealer cap, apply a generous layer of bead sealer to the rim flange. Focus on areas where you noticed heavy corrosion earlier.

You can also apply a thin layer directly to the tire bead. Do not wait for it to dry completely; it is designed to be “wet” when the tire is inflated.

Step 4: Inflate and Seat the Bead

Remove the valve core from the stem to maximize airflow. Connect your air chuck and begin filling the tire with compressed air.

You should hear two distinct “pops” as the beads jump over the safety humps and lock against the flanges. This indicates a successful seat.

Advanced Techniques for Stubborn Off-Road Tires

Off-roaders often run wider tires on narrower rims, which makes knowing how to seal a tire to the rim even more challenging. The gap between the bead and the rim can be too large for air to catch.

If the air is escaping faster than the compressor can fill it, you need to “pinch” the tire. This forces the sidewalls outward toward the rim edges.

The most common DIY method is using a heavy-duty ratchet strap. Wrap the strap around the center of the tire tread and tighten it until the sidewalls bulge out.

This creates a temporary seal that allows the air pressure to take over. Once the beads start to move toward the rim, quickly release the strap to avoid trapping it.

The “High Volume” Air Trick

Sometimes a standard shop compressor isn’t enough for large 37-inch or 40-inch tires. In these cases, using a “bead blaster” or an air tank with a large discharge valve is necessary.

These tools dump a massive amount of air into the tire in a fraction of a second. This sudden pressure is often the only way to seat a tire that has been sitting in a cold garage and has become stiff.

Dealing with Cold Rubber

Rubber becomes less flexible in cold temperatures. If you are struggling with how to seal a tire to the rim in winter, try bringing the tire inside a heated room for a few hours.

Warm rubber is much more pliable and will stretch over the rim humps more easily. This simple trick can save you hours of frustration and prevents damage to the tire bead.

Troubleshooting Common Sealing Issues

Even with the best preparation, you might still find a leak. The first thing to check is the valve stem itself, as these often fail before the bead does.

Spray a mixture of soap and water around the valve stem and the bead. If you see bubbles forming, you have found the source of your leak.

If bubbles are coming from the bead area despite using sealer, the rim may be warped or bent. A bent rim flange will never hold a perfect seal regardless of how much chemical sealer you use.

  • Leaking Valve Core: Tighten the core or replace it with a new one.
  • Cracked Valve Stem: Rubber stems dry rot over time; replace them during every tire change.
  • Pinhole Rim Leaks: Aluminum wheels can develop porous spots; bead sealer can sometimes fix this if applied to the inner barrel.

Safety Precautions and Professional Standards

Working with pressurized tires is inherently dangerous. Never exceed the maximum inflation pressure listed on the tire sidewall while trying to seat a bead.

Most passenger tires have a “seating pressure” limit of 40 PSI. If the bead has not popped by then, deflate the tire, re-lubricate, and try again.

Keep your hands and fingers away from the bead area during inflation. If the bead snaps into place while your finger is in the way, it can cause severe injury or bone fractures.

Always use a clip-on air chuck with an extension hose if possible. This allows you to stand back from the tire while it is reaching high pressures, providing a safety buffer in case of a catastrophic failure.

Frequently Asked Questions About Sealing Tires

Can I use WD-40 to seal a tire to the rim?

You should avoid using WD-40 or other petroleum-based lubricants. These chemicals can degrade the rubber of the tire over time and may cause the tire to slip on the rim during hard braking.

Is bead sealer permanent?

Bead sealer is a semi-permanent solution. It will stay in place for the life of the tire but can be easily scraped off the rim the next time you change your tires. It does not “glue” the tire on permanently.

How long does bead sealer take to dry?

Most bead sealers remain tacky for a long time. However, you can generally drive on the tire immediately after inflation. The internal pressure of the tire keeps the sealer compressed against the rim.

What if my rim is too rusty to seal?

If the rust has created deep pits in the metal, a wire brush might not be enough. You may need to use a grinding stone or a flap disc to smooth the metal, then apply a zinc-rich primer before using bead sealer.
